MICROWAVE OVEN
care of your microwave oven
The oven should be cleaned regularly and any
food deposits removed.
Failure to maintain the oven in a clean
condition could lead to deterioration
of the surface that could adversely
affect the life of the appliance
and possibly result in a hazardous
situation.
1. Turn the oven off before cleaning.
2. Keep the inside of the oven clean. When
food spatters or spilled liquids adhere to
oven walls, wipe with a damp cloth. Mild
detergent may be used if the oven gets
very dirty. The use of harsh detergent or
abrasives is not recommended.
3. The outside oven surface should be
cleaned with soap and water, rinsed and
dried with a soft cloth. To prevent damage
to the operating parts inside the oven,
water should not be allowed to seep into
the ventilation openings.
4. If the control panel becomes wet, clean
with a soft, dry cloth. Do not use harsh
detergents or abrasives on the control
panel.
5. If steam accumulates inside or around the
outside of the oven door, wipe with a soft
cloth. This may occur when the microwave
oven is operated under high humidity
conditions and in no way indicates
malfunction of the unit.
6. It is occasionally necessary to remove the
glass tray for cleaning. Wash the tray in
warm sudsy water or in a dishwasher.
7. TheO ven cavity floor should be cleaned
regularly to avoid excessive noise. Simply
wipe the bottom surface of the oven with
mild detergent water or window cleaner
and dry. The roller guide may be washed in
mild sudsy water.
Roller Guide
1. The ROLLER GUIDE and oven floor should
be cleaned frequently to prevent excessive
noise.
2. The ROLLER GUIDE MUST ALWAYS be
used for cooking together with the glass
tray.
glaSS tray
1. DO NOT operate the oven without the
glass tray in place.
2. DO NOT use any other glass tray with this
oven.
3. If glass tray is hot, ALLOW TO COOL
before cleaning or placing it in water.
4. DO NOT cook directly on the glass tray
(Except for popcorn).
